YorkshireBoy wrote: »Neither! It's from the date they tell you the switch was completed until the day before this date the following month. For example, my switch was completed on 28th November, so my 'funding month' runs from the 28th to the 27th of the following month.There's no queue with online banking. You should try it.
I'm a little concerned now having read the above...
My switch date was the 26 October 2011 and the way I understood it was, I should then deposit £800.00 every month for the next 3 months ie Any time in November / December / January
My first payment of £800.00 went in on the 22nd November
Is this OK?
Many thanks0 -
I'd say thats fine, as it went in before the month. If you had paid it on the 27th November, then I would say it would have been too late.
Try and pay it in on the same time each month.0 -
